In This Episode
If you subscribe to the PetaPixel Photography Podcast in iTunes, please take a moment to rate and review us and help us move up in the rankings so others interested in photography may find us.
Photographer and Lensbaby founder Craig Strong open the show. Thanks Craig!
Canon super sizes by patenting a 1000mm lens. (#)
Calumet Photographic and Bowens Lighting are acquired with plans for expansion. (#)
The British Journal of Photography raises a ton of cash to keep things going strong and serve its digital audience. (#)
A top photojournalist and his interpreter are killed in Afghanistan. (#)
Sony Artisan of Imagery and host of "The Photo Show" live on Facebook, Brian Matiash, features the PetaPixel Photography Podcast calling it "One of the best photography podcasts I've ever heard." (@ 19m26s)
Yet more in developments in the Steve McCurry saga as photos are alleged to have been staged. (#)

| 0:59.0 | Thank you so much Craig for opening this show. |
| 1:01.2 | I greatly appreciate it, brother. You know some of the |
| 1:03.7 | best photography products in the market come from the minds of fellow |
| 1:07.4 | photographers and such is the case with Craig Strong inventor of Lens Baby. |
| 1:13.3 | It all began when Craig wanted to get the creative looks that he had back in the film days, |
| 1:17.6 | so not seeing products on the market which would do what he wanted, the former photojournalist |
| 1:22.0 | decided to create it for himself. |
| 1:24.3 | Some 40-plus products later, the Lens Baby system is the go-to choice for getting creative looks |
| 1:29.6 | in camera rather than messing around later in post processing and being all frustrated. |
